WebNov 17, 2014 · Correcting an Error in a Recorded Real Estate Document Errors in a deed may create uncertainty about the title and cause problems when the current owner tries to transfer the property at a later point. Executing and recording a correction document is an easy way to prevent this. WebA tax rate area (tax authority group) is a parcel or group of parcels of property that are within the boundaries of identical taxing agencies and are used in order that a total uniform tax rate may be applied to a given area.
